Answer:
(x + 5) (x + 4)
Step-by-step explanation:
Simplify the following:
x^2 + 9 x + 20
The factors of 20 that sum to 9 are 5 and 4. So, x^2 + 9 x + 20 = (x + 5) (x + 4):
